如何在GitHub上更改名字:全面指南

在使用GitHub的过程中,很多用户可能会考虑更改他们的名字,包括GitHub用户名和仓库名称。更改名字可能是因为职业变动、品牌重塑,或者简单地想换个风格。本文将详细介绍如何在GitHub上更改名字,包括具体步骤和注意事项。

目录

为什么要更改GitHub名字

更改GitHub名字有很多原因,其中包括:

  • 职业变动:换工作后,可能需要更新个人信息。
  • 品牌重塑:个人项目或团队需要重新命名以符合新的定位。
  • 隐私保护:希望隐藏真实姓名或使用更符合个人品牌的名字。

更改GitHub用户名的步骤

1. 登录GitHub账户

首先,访问GitHub官网并使用你的账号登录。

2. 访问账户设置

  • 点击右上角的个人头像。
  • 从下拉菜单中选择Settings

3. 更改用户名

  • Account选项卡下,找到Change username部分。
  • 输入新的用户名,并检查是否可用。
  • 如果可用,点击Change username按钮。

4. 确认更改

  • GitHub可能会要求你确认此更改,并会显示相应的警告信息。
  • 完成后,GitHub会自动更新相关链接和信息。

更改GitHub仓库名的步骤

1. 登录并访问仓库

同样地,先登录GitHub,然后进入你想要更改名称的仓库。

2. 进入仓库设置

  • 点击Settings选项卡,位于仓库页面的右上角。

3. 更改仓库名

  • Repository name字段中输入新的仓库名称。
  • 确认无误后,点击页面底部的Rename按钮。

4. 处理重定向

  • GitHub会自动为旧的仓库名创建重定向,以确保旧链接仍然有效。

更改名字后的影响

更改名字后,会有一些影响需要注意:

  • 旧链接的重定向:GitHub会为旧用户名和仓库名设置重定向,用户可以通过旧链接访问,但这并不是永久解决方案。

  • Git操作:使用Git的用户需要更新本地仓库的远程URL。可以通过以下命令来更改:

    git remote set-url origin https://github.com/新用户名/新仓库名.git

  • 团队与组织:如果你是组织的管理员,更改用户名可能会影响到组织内的链接和权限设置。

常见问题解答

更改GitHub用户名会影响现有的Fork和Stars吗?

不会,Fork和Stars不会因为用户名更改而丢失。用户仍然可以看到Fork和Stars的数量。

如何恢复之前的用户名?

如果你希望恢复到之前的用户名,通常可以在更改后的一段时间内完成。但如果用户名被他人注册,可能无法再使用。建议在更改前考虑清楚。

更改仓库名称是否会影响CI/CD流程?

是的,如果你在CI/CD工具中使用了旧仓库名,可能需要更新配置文件中的相关链接。

更改用户名后需要更新本地仓库吗?

是的,你需要更新本地仓库的远程链接,以确保继续能够推送和拉取代码。

如何查看GitHub用户名是否可用?

在更改用户名的设置页面输入新的用户名,GitHub会自动提示该用户名是否可用。

正文完